We are waiting for sub-systems like CAFRAD AESA Radar complex , 127mm naval gun , SIPER Block2 SAM , GEZGIN land attack Cruise Missile , etc
-- MIDLAS VLS is ready
-- ADVENT Network Enabled Combat Management System is ready
-- IFF System ( Identification Friend or Foe ) is ready
-- FERSAH Hull Mounted Sonar is ready
-- HIZIR-LFAS Low Frequency Towed Active Sonar is ready
-- ARES-2N Electronic Warfare System is ready
-- HIZIR Torpedo counter measure System is ready
-- TORK Hard-Kill Torpedo Countermeasure System is ready
-- SeaEye-AHTAPOT EO Reconnaisance and Survellience System is ready
-- KULAC echo sounder is ready
-- PIRI IRST is ready
-- STOP 25 mm Machine Gun Platform is ready
-- GOKDENIZ 35 mm CIWS is ready
-- NAZAR LASER EW System is ready
-- HISAR-D ( SAPAN ) SAM is ready
-- ATMACA anti-ship Missile is ready
-- ORKA lightweight Torpedo
Commander of the Naval Forces, Admiral. Ercüment Tatlıoğlu 19.01.2024
"We are working to turn our TF-2000 Air Defense Warfare Destroyer and Aircraft Carrier into a construction project"
Turkiye will start production TF-2000 Destroyer in 2025-2026
now Turkiye focused on 8 ISTIF class Frigates

Turkey doesn't need help building corvettes, frigates, destroyers, etc. Where Turkey needs help is submarines, thats the one area where codevelopment would be beneficial. Otherwise Turkey is largely self sufficient on the ship building front. Everything except for the propulsion system, Turkey is more or less building inhouse.
